Thanks for visiting Mascus
We think our Ritchie List website serves you better. Click the button below to go there now.
Articulated boom lifts 2021 126 h United States, Salt Lake City, UT
Other 2016 United States, London, Ohio
Articulated boom lifts 2008 United States, Avon, Ohio
Trailer Mounted Aerial Platforms 2026 United States, Bristol, Pennsylvania